What is 5960 00 072 0083?

The part number 5960 00 072 0083 falls under the electron tube category. Electron tubes are engineered to operate in environments where modern solid state components may not meet performance or certification requirements.



These components are defined by exact electrical behavior. That is why part number accuracy is critical. Even small deviations can lead to performance instability or system rejection during inspection.

Why electron tubes still matter?

Despite advances in electronics many mission critical systems were designed decades ago. These systems were certified using specific components and cannot be easily redesigned.

Electron tubes continue to be used because they offer

  1. High tolerance to voltage and current stress
  2. Stable signal performance
  3. Resistance to electromagnetic interference
  4. Proven reliability over long service life

Because of these advantages parts like 5960 00 072 0083 remain essential.

Why sourcing is challenging?

The biggest challenge with 5960 00 072 0083 is availability. Many electron tubes are no longer produced in large quantities. Buyers must rely on legacy inventory and secondary suppliers.

This creates risks such as

  1. Inaccurate inventory listings
  2. Incorrect or incomplete part numbers
  3. Unverified condition claims
  4. Lack of traceability or documentation

Without careful sourcing these risks can derail projects quickly.

The importance of exact matching

In regulated systems exact part matching is mandatory. Substitutions are rarely approved and often rejected outright.

If system documentation specifies 5960 00 072 0083 then only that exact component should be installed. Anything else introduces compliance risk and potential system failure.

Precision at the sourcing stage protects everything downstream.

Quality control considerations

Electron tubes require careful handling and storage. Even unused components can degrade if exposed to improper conditions.

Quality control best practices include
Controlled temperature and humidity
Minimal handling before shipment
Accurate labeling and packaging
Supplier level verification

Storage and handling best practices

To preserve performance electron tubes should be stored in stable environments with controlled humidity and temperature. Original packaging should be retained whenever possible.

Proper storage ensures the component performs as intended when installed.
